Output e823340614db4a41dad5a51477ea0ab64a27e17791a8fcdae9b1a2a8764e7c96:0

value
1288714
script pubkey
OP_0 OP_PUSHBYTES_20 8d7afed18433b3017389199a8011845ef2423fc6
address
bc1q34a0a5vyxweszuufrxdgqyvytmeyy07xna4m3r
transaction
e823340614db4a41dad5a51477ea0ab64a27e17791a8fcdae9b1a2a8764e7c96
spent
true